    Virtual FlexFuel has some fun aspects to it. If you plan to switch between E60 and E10, invest the ~$100 in a real ethanol sensor and wire it up. There are full plug n play kits available for ~$300 for sensor/wiring/fuel line adapters as well. No more guessing or worrying about the ECM sticking with the wrong Ethanol % in the tune...
